Young pacer in line for Test debut as Sri Lanka name squad for Pakistan series

Sri Lanka have named a strong 16-man squad for a two-match Test series against Pakistan starting on 16 July.

After an impressive start to his white team career, left pacer Dilshan Madushanka is looking to make his Test debut He has been called up to the Sri Lanka national team for two Test matches against Pakistan.

The 22-year-old had played 6 ODIs, 11 T20Is so far and was in the 2022 ICC Men’s T20 World Cup squad before suffering an injury.

He was recently named Player of the Match in the 2023 ICC Men’s Cricket World Cup Qualifying Final against the Netherlands after scoring 3/18 in an impressive new-ball season.

Dimus Karnalatne remains captain despite recently announcing his intention to step down from his future role in his new ICC World Test Championship cycle.

Off-spinner Laksita Manasinha is another newcomer to the team. Ofspinner was called up to the test squad for last year’s match against Pakistan, replacing Mahesh Teekshana, but did not make his debut.

The series will start in Goal on his 16th July and the second Test will start in Colombo on his 24th July.


Sri Lanka: Dimus Karunaratne (c), Nishan Madushka (week), Ksar Mendis, Angelo Matthews, Dinesh Chandimal, Dhananjaya de Silva, Pathum Nissanka, Sadheera Samarawikrama (week), Kamindu Mendis, Ramesh Mendis, Prabhas Jayasuriya, Praveen Jayawikrama, Kasun Rajta, Dilshan Madhushanka, Vishwa Fernando, Lakshita Manasinha
